Rethinking the creating Blocks: The purpose of Green Raw Materials
The foundation of any peptide is its amino acid monomers as well as reagents used to link them. The green technique commences right here, scrutinizing each individual enter for its environmental affect and efficiency.
Eco-helpful Reagents and Monomers: ordinarily, peptide synthesis has included toxic and harmful coupling reagents. The eco-friendly chemistry movement champions the event and adoption of reagents with decreased toxicity profiles and better response performance. This minimizes hazardous byproducts and boosts employee protection. Also, There's a expanding pattern toward sourcing amino acids from bio-centered or renewable feedstocks, transferring faraway from an entire dependence on petrochemical derivatives.
Carbon Footprint Transparency: major suppliers are starting to Assess and disclose the carbon footprint in their Uncooked materials. This life-cycle evaluation supplies a holistic watch of a fabric's environmental effects, from its creation to its use, enabling For additional informed and dependable sourcing conclusions.
Smarter Synthesis: Optimizing the Peptide Production Process
Efficiency is actually a core tenet of green chemistry. In peptide synthesis, this translates to processes which can be quicker, create better yields, and produce considerably less waste, specifically impacting the quality and price of the ultimate products.
Automation for Precision and Reduced Waste: Automated peptide synthesis platforms are getting to be the industry standard. These devices minimize human error, make certain specific reagent delivery, and optimize reaction periods. This precision appreciably cuts down the consumption of expensive and sometimes dangerous raw components, specifically contributing to your greener, additional cost-effective system.
Maximizing produce and Atom economic system: The purpose will be to layout reactions wherever the utmost amount of atoms from the starting up supplies are integrated into the ultimate products. By optimizing reaction situations and cutting down the amount of synthesis methods, companies can drastically improve General generate. This don't just conserves assets but additionally simplifies the purification method, An important bottleneck in peptide manufacturing.
true-Time approach Monitoring: utilizing applications like serious-time substantial-overall performance Liquid Chromatography (HPLC) monitoring will allow chemists to trace the response's development precisely. This stops around-response, which may result in side-item formation, and below-response, which ends up in very low generate. The end result is a more controlled, efficient, and waste-decreasing synthesis.
further than the Flask: Sustainable Solvent administration
Solvents tend to be the lifeblood of peptide synthesis, but Also they are its best environmental liability. conventional solvents like Dimethylformamide (DMF) and Dichloromethane (DCM) are powerful but pose substantial health and environmental dangers.
Adopting Greener Solvents: The look for and adoption of eco-friendly solvents is often a top rated precedence. Safer alternate options like ethyl acetate, two-methyltetrahydrofuran (2-MeTHF), and also novel drinking water-based mostly programs are being built-in into equally reliable-stage and liquid-section synthesis protocols. While no solvent is ideal, the shift in the direction of the ones that are biodegradable, less poisonous, and derived from renewable sources is a monumental action ahead.
employing Closed-Loop Solvent Recycling: instead of treating made use of solvents as disposable squander, forward-pondering corporations are buying Superior distillation and purification systems. These techniques can recover a higher proportion of solvents post-synthesis, allowing for them to be recycled and reused inside a closed-loop technique. This drastically lowers both of those the use of virgin solvents and the amount of dangerous liquid squander.
planning Out Disposal: A concentrate on Waste Minimization
quite possibly the most sustainable sort of squander is the waste that isn't established. inexperienced chemistry prioritizes developing procedures that inherently lessen the generation of strong and liquid byproducts.
minimal-Residue Processes: By improving atom overall economy and reaction effectiveness, the amount of unwanted byproducts and residual reagents is of course reduced. This "small-residue" approach simplifies purification and lessens the load on squander cure facilities. for any person sourcing a fat reduction peptide, a cleaner synthesis procedure frequently correlates using a purer ultimate solution.
Strategic Waste Stream administration: When waste is unavoidable, it should be managed responsibly. This requires segregating different types of waste streams—as an example, separating halogenated solvents from non-halogenated types. This allows for more effective cure and produces opportunities for recovering and click here repurposing selected byproducts, turning a possible waste into a potential resource.
